Key Takeaways
- Quantum computing expected to optimize $450-850 billion in manufacturing value by 2035 per McKinsey.
- Quantum algorithms could unlock $1 trillion annual value in chemicals/materials industry by 2035.
- Pharma drug discovery accelerated 10x via quantum sims, saving $100 billion/year projected.
- Total private investment in quantum tech reached $2.35 billion cumulatively by end of 2022, with $1.7 billion in 2023 alone.
- U.S. government allocated $1.2 billion to quantum initiatives via National Quantum Initiative in 2023.
- McKinsey reports $40 billion total quantum funding since 2010s start, peaking at $2.5 billion in 2022.
- The global quantum technology market size was valued at USD 1.16 billion in 2023 and is projected to grow at a CAGR of 32.7% from 2024 to 2030.
- Quantum computing hardware market revenue reached $400 million in 2023, expected to hit $8.6 billion by 2030 at 34% CAGR.
- The quantum sensors market is anticipated to grow from $389 million in 2023 to $1.7 billion by 2028 at a CAGR of 34.2%.
- Number of quantum patents filed globally reached 10,000 cumulatively by 2023, with 2,500 new in 2023 alone.
- U.S. leads with 40% of global quantum patents, 4,000 issued by 2023.
- China filed 1,800 quantum tech patents in 2023, surpassing U.S. filings.
- Global quantum workforce estimated at 10,000 specialists in 2023.
- U.S. quantum talent pool 5,000 PhDs and researchers by 2023.
- Quantum jobs grew 250% from 2019-2023 to 15,000 postings annually.
Quantum momentum is surging, with billions invested, fast market growth, and thousands of new jobs and patents.
